/*
* Define DENORM_OPERAND to make the emulator detect denormals
* and use the denormal flag of the status word. Note: this only
* affects the flag and corresponding interrupt, the emulator
* will always generate denormals and operate upon them as required.
*/
#define DENORM_OPERAND
/*
* Define PECULIAR_486 to get a closer approximation to 80486 behaviour,
* rather than behaviour which appears to be cleaner.
* This is a matter of opinion: for all I know, the 80486 may simply
* be complying with the IEEE spec. Maybe one day I'll get to see the
* spec...
*/
#define PECULIAR_486
